Capcom Responds To Recent Dragon’s Dogma 2 Paid DLC Controversy

Dragon’s Dogma 2 has been facing a number of criticisms, particularly on the PC side of things.

While the game has received glowing review from critics, that isn’t the case on Steam. The game received a mixed reception on the platform, with 40% positive reviews out of 9,300 user reviews. This is due to several factors:

  • The game isn’t optimized well for PC. The fact that Capcom sent us a launch PS5 copy of the game when we requested for a PC code speaks volumes.
  • The game has 21 separate DLC purchases on Day 1. These purchases are for items that are easy to obtain in-game for free.

Here’s the list of the DLC that’s available for purchase, which you can also get in-game:

  • Art of Metamorphosis – Character Editor
  • Ambivalent Rift Incense – Change Pawn Inclinations
  • Portcrystal – Warp Location Marker
  • Wakestone – Restore the dead to life!
  • 500 Rift Crystals / 1500 Rift Crystals / 2500 Rift Crystals – Points to Spend Beyond the Rift
  • Makeshift Gaol Key – Escape from gaol!
  • Harpysnare Smoke Beacons – Harpy Lure Item

As such, Capcom has posted the following message in light of the complaints:

“We would like to update you on the status of the following items, about which we have received numerous comments from the community. To all those looking forward to this game, we sincerely apologize for any inconvenience.

?Crashes and bug fixes
We are investigating/fixing critical problems such as crashes and freezing.
We will be addressing crashes and bug fixes starting from those with the highest priority in patches in the near future.

?The option of starting a new game
We are looking at adding a feature to the Steam version of the game that will allow players that are already playing to restart the game. We will announce more details as soon as we can.

?Regarding Frame Rate
A large amount of CPU usage is allocated to each character and calculating the impact of their physical presence in various areas. In certain situations where numerous characters appear simultaneously, the CPU usage can be very high and may affect the frame rate. We are aware that in such situations, settings that reduce GPU load may currently have a limited effect; however, we are looking into ways to improve performance in the future.”

Dragon’s Dogma 2 is out now for PC, PS5, and Xbox Series. You may want to get the console versions first in the meantime given this recent news.
